Ver Mensaje Individual
  #2 (permalink)  
Antiguo 08/08/2018, 13:28
Avatar de gogupe
gogupe
 
Fecha de Ingreso: octubre-2006
Ubicación: Mallorca
Mensajes: 897
Antigüedad: 17 años, 6 meses
Puntos: 32
Respuesta: Background con carrusel de videos youtube

Tengo el siguiente código que funciona correctamente, lo que no se hacer es para pasarle un array de videos y que sean consecutivos y haga un loop.



Código HTML:
<!DOCTYPE HTML>
<html lang="es">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title></title>

<style>
body
	{
		margin:0;padding:0;
	}
#player_wrap{position:relative;padding-bottom:56.25%;height:0;overflow:hidden;max-width:100%}
#player_wrap iframe{position:absolute;top:0;left:0;width:100%;height:100%}

</style>
</head>
<body>


<script>
function inicio_galeria() {
    $('#player_wrap').remove();
    $('#pase').camera({
        fx: 'simpleFade',
        pagination: true,
        height: 'auto',
        time: 5000,
        autoAdvance:true,
        thumbnails: true
    });
}
var tag = document.createElement('script');
tag.src = "https://www.youtube.com/iframe_api";
var firstScriptTag = document.getElementsByTagName('script')[0];
firstScriptTag.parentNode.insertBefore(tag, firstScriptTag);
var player;
function onYouTubeIframeAPIReady() {
  player = new YT.Player('player', {
    height: '100%',
    width: '100%',
    videoId: 'vabnZ9-ex7o',
    playerVars: {
        showinfo: 0,
        rel: 0,
        controls: 0
    },
    events: {
      'onReady': onPlayerReady,
      'onStateChange': onPlayerStateChange
    }
  });
}
function onPlayerReady(event) {
  event.target.playVideo();
  event.target.mute();
}
function onPlayerStateChange(event) {
  if (event.data == YT.PlayerState.ENDED) {
		//Iniciar funcion
  }
}
</script>
  <div id="player_wrap"><div id="player"></div>

</body>
</html> 
__________________
Somos una serie de acontecimiento que puede venir al caso en un momento dado.